Thread: pgsql: During index build, check and elog (not just Assert) for broken
During index build, check and elog (not just Assert) for broken HOT chain. The recently-fixed bug in WAL replay could result in not finding a parent tuple for a heap-only tuple. The existing code would either Assert or generate an invalid index entry, neither of which is desirable. Throw a regular error instead.
